Amdocs barred from billing tender in Indonesia
The Indonesian Ministry of Communication and Information Technology announced last Tuesday that it is investigating telecommunications companies that do business with Israel.
This announcement came the day after the communication and information technology minister disclosed that Amdocs was being excluded from a local tender because the controlling shareholders are Israeli.
The Jakarta Globe reported that on Monday Communications and Information Technology Minister Tifatul Sembiring said that Amdocs should not be included in the billing tender of Indonesian cellular service provider Telkom PT because Amdocs has Israeli shareholders. A spokesman said the ministry will investigate Israeli-affiliated telecommunications companies and sanction those found to be in violation of the regulation.
Sembiring is a member of PKS, the conservative Islamic Prosperous Justice Party, and said excluding Amdocs from the tender was justified because Israel has no diplomatic relations with Indonesia.
The newspaper also noted the criticism from a local consumer organization, whose analyst called Sembiring’s action “irrelevant” and unwise. The analyst said that Israeli technology was commonly used in the information-technology sector because Israel is a major producer of high-tech components, and Indonesia imports 90% of the telecommunication parts used in the country.
“Many of these could be from Israeli manufacturers or come from companies with Israeli shareholders,” he said. “How about products from Taiwan? Many of our telecommunications products are from Taiwan – another country that does not have diplomatic relations with Indonesia.” (taken from: Haaretz.com)
